POSITION SUMMARY:
Orsini is seeking a Production Reporting Analyst to support the Operational Excellence and Pharmacy Operations teams. This role will be responsible for developing reporting, dashboards, and ad hoc analysis that help Operations leadership understand performance, identify root causes, and drive business improvement.
This position requires more than technical reporting capability. The successful candidate must be able to thoughtfully analyze operational data, interpret trends, identify performance drivers, and translate findings into clear insights and recommendations for leadership. The analyst will work closely with Operations leaders to support daily production visibility, workflow improvement, capacity planning, therapy performance, revenue-related operational analysis, and key process improvement initiatives.
The ideal candidate is highly analytical, operationally curious, comfortable working with imperfect data, and able to move quickly from raw data to actionable business insight.
Key Responsibilities
- Develop, maintain, and improve daily, weekly, and monthly reporting for Pharmacy Operations, Operational Excellence, and related leadership teams.
- Build and maintain dashboards and scorecards that provide clear visibility into operational performance, production trends, workflow bottlenecks, and key business drivers.
- Perform ad hoc analysis to answer critical business questions, including trend analysis, variance analysis, root-cause analysis, productivity analysis, aging analysis, cycle-time analysis, and operational opportunity sizing.
- Partner with Operations leaders to define meaningful KPIs, standardize metric definitions, and ensure reporting reflects how the business actually operates.
- Translate complex data into clear, concise insights and recommendations that support leadership decision-making.
- Identify performance gaps, process bottlenecks, and improvement opportunities across pharmacy operations, intake, enrollment, prior authorization, scheduling, fulfillment, and related workflows.
- Support operational reviews by preparing executive-ready analysis, summaries, and visualizations.
- Collaborate with cross-functional teams to investigate production issues, reconcile data discrepancies, and improve data quality.
- Participate in data acquisition, transformation, and automation efforts from multiple operational systems and data sources.
- Leverage tools such as Excel, Power BI, SQL Server, SSRS, SSIS, PowerShell, Claude, Copilot, or other AI-enabled tools to improve speed, quality, and efficiency of reporting and analysis.
- Support audits, quality control processes, and continuous improvement initiatives as needed.
- Proactively recommend improvements to reporting structure, dashboard usability, metric design, and analytical approach.
